数字电子技术 第1章 数制及编码.ppt

  1. 1、本文档共51页,可阅读全部内容。
  2. 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
  3. 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  4. 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多
数字电子技术 第1章 数制及编码

1.1.1 模拟信号与数字信号 模拟信号是指时间上和幅度上均为连续取值的物理量。 在自然环境下,大多数物理信号都是模拟量。如温度是一个模拟量,某一天的温度在不同时间的变化情况就是一条光滑、连续的曲线: 数字信号是指时间上和幅度上均为离散取值的物理量。 可以把模拟信号变成数字信号,其方法是对模拟信号进行采样,并用数字代码表示后的信号即为数字信号。 用逻辑1和0表示的数字信号波形如下图所示: 1.1.2 数字电路的特点 数字电路的结构是以二值数字逻辑为基础的,其中的工作信号是离散的数字信号。电路中的电子器件工作于开关状态。 数字电路分析的重点已不是其输入、输出间波形的数值关系,而是输入、输出序列间的逻辑关系。 所采用的分析工具是逻辑代数,表达电路的功能主要是功能表、真值表、逻辑表达式、布尔函数以及波形图。 数字系统一般容易设计。 信息的处理、存储和传输能力更强。 数字系统的精确度及精度容易保存一致。 数字电路抗干扰能力强。 数字电路容易制造在IC芯片上。 1.2 数制 表示数码中每一位的构成及进位的规则称为进位计数制,简称数制。 进位计数制也叫位置计数制 。在这种计数制中,同一个数码在不同的数位上所表示的数值是不同的。 一种数制中允许使用的数码符号的个数称为该数制的基数。记作R 某个数位上数码为1时所表征的数值,称为该数位的权值,简称“权”。 利用基数和“权”的概念,可以把一个R进制数D用下列形式表示: 1.2.1 十进制数 十进制的基数R为10,采用十个数码符号0、1、2、3、4、5、6、7、8、9 十进制的按权展开式为: 如十进制数2745.214 可表示为: 1.2.2 二进制数 所谓二进制,就是基数R为2的进位计数制,它只有0和1两个数码符号。 二进制的按权展开式为: 如二进制数1011.1012可表示为: 用N位二进制可实现2N个计数,可表示的最大数是2N-1 例1-1: 用8位二进制能表示的最大数是多少? 解: 二进制数的加、减、乘、除四则运算 二进制的计数规则是:低位向相邻高位“逢二进一,借一为二”。 二进制加法: 二进制的加法运算有如下规则: 0 + 0 = 0 0 + 1 = 1 1 + 0 = 1 1 + 1 = 10 (“逢二进一”) 例1-2: 1011.1012 + 10.012 = ? 二进制减法: 二进制的减法运算有如下规则: 0 – 0 = 0 1 – 0 = 1 1 – 1 = 0 0 – 1 = 1 (“借一当二”) 例1-3 : 1101.1112 – 10.012 = ? 1.2.3 八进制数 八进制数的基数R是8,它有0、1、2、3、4、5、6、7共八个有效数码。 八进制的按权展开式为: 八进制的计数规则是:低位向相邻高位“逢八进一,借一为八”。 例1-6: 对八进制数,从08数到308 解: 所求的八进制数的序列如下所示(注意,没有使用下标8)。 0,1,2,3,4,5,6,7, 10,11,12,13,14,15,16,17,20, 21,22,23,24,25,26,27, 30 1.2.4 十六进制数 十六进制数的基数R是16,它有0、1、2、3、4、5、6、7、8、9、A、B、C、D、E、F共十六个有效数码。 十六进制的按权展开式为: 十六进制的计数规则是:低位向相邻高位“逢十六进一,借一为十六”。 例1-7: 对十六进制数,从016数到3016 解: 所求的十六进制数的序列如下所示(注意,没有使用下标16)。 1.3 数制转换 主要内容: 二进制数与八进制数、十六进制数之间的相互转换方法 十进制数与二进制数、八进制数、十六进制数的相互转换方法 把一个数从一种数制转换到其他数制的转换方法 1.3.1 二进制数与八进制数的相互转换 将二进制数转换为八进制数 将整数部分自右往左开始,每3位分成一组,最后剩余不足3位时在左边补0;小数部分自左往右,每3位一组,最后剩余不足3位时在右边补0;然后用等价的八进制替换每组数据 例1-8: 将二进制10112转换为八进制数。 对每位八进制数,只需将其展开成3位二进制数即可 例1-9: 将八进制数67.7218转换为二进制数。 解:对每个八进制位,写出对应的3位二进制数。 1.3.2 二进制数与十六进制数的相互转换 将二进制数转换为十六进制数 将整数部分自右往左开始,每四位分成一组,最后剩余不足四位时在左边补0;小数部分自左往右,每四位一组,最后剩余不足四位时在右边补0;然后用等价的十六进制替换每组数

文档评论(0)

ipbohn97 + 关注
实名认证
内容提供者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档